Where to see Great Grebe

  • Breeding region South America
  • Breeding subregion coastal w Peru; Paraguay and se Brazil to s Chile and Argentina

Great Grebe subspecies (2)

SubspeciesBreeding subregionNonbreeding subregionExtinct
Podiceps major majorcoastal w Peru; Paraguay and se Brazil to c Chile and s Argentina-No
Podiceps major navasis Chile-No
